Compared to Do-It-Yourself firework displays, you will get better value for money with a professional display. This is because with consumer fireworks, the shop which you buy it from needs to make a profit. Besides, such shops have to conform to BS7114. This all introduces costs which professional fired displays do not have to deal with.

Note that Alcohol and pyrotechnics do not mix. Do not allow young children to handle or ignite pyrotechnics. Follow local regulations with regard to type and use. Use in a clear, open area. Pyrotechnics should be deployed on a hard surface, preferably concrete and have water nearby to control fire.

Be guided, as we said earlier, by local regulations and the physical space available to you. City dwellers should avoid mortars, roman candles, rockets, and other types of pyrotechnics that fly beyond your available space and therefore control. The best choices may comprise of small fountains, sparklers, cones, small firecrackers, snakes, among others.

A good display operator will conduct a site inspection in advance of the event to ensure the venue is acceptable and will let local fire services, police and where necessary airports aware of your display. There would be nothing worse than the police or fire brigade arriving at your event because they fireworks where seen as a distress flare or property on fire.
